Abstract

To provide a hanger that may be easily carried and be shrunk.SOLUTION: A hanger includes a grip ring 18. A screw shaft 40 extending vertically is provided to the grip ring. A folding box 19 located under the grip ring is connected so that it can rotate. Folding grooves 20 are provided in the folding box. A detaching chamber 37 is provided between the folding grooves. A detaching part is provided in the detaching chamber. The detaching part controls the expansion angle of a crossbar 21. Due to different expansion and shrinkage with the same shaft and under different fixation conditions, realized is conversion between an operation state and a free state of the hunger. In addition, due to a changeable angle of the included angle of the hunger, operation for detaching a cloth from the hunger is optimized when the cloth is put on the hunger and the shape of the cloth is protected from deformation.SELECTED DRAWING: Figure 1

本発明装置は初期状態にある時、活動ヒンジ連結盤44と固定ヒンジ連結盤16との間の距離が一番短く、フック46を隠し溝11の中に位置させ、ヒンジ連結フレーム42を当接板15と当接させ、また押出ロッド13を推し動かして足踏み式ポンプ50を圧させ、足踏み式ポンプ50の中の気体が通気管47を通してピストン48を推し動かし、それにより磁力棒49を押出ロッド13と当接させ、遮蔽蓋26が折畳溝20の外側に覆われ、またローラ25と横木21との当接により、横木21が折畳溝20の中に収められ、昇降枠38が引き板32と当接していない。 When the device of the present invention is in the initial state, the distance between the active hinge connecting plate 44 and the fixed hinge connecting plate 16 is the shortest, the hook 46 is positioned in the hidden groove 11, and the hinge connecting frame 42 abuts. It is brought into contact with the plate 15 and the extrusion rod 13 is pushed to press the foot pump 50, and the gas in the foot pump 50 pushes the piston 48 through the ventilation pipe 47, thereby pushing the magnetic rod 49 to the extrusion rod. The shielding lid 26 is covered with the outside of the folding groove 20 by abutting with 13, and the crossbar 21 is housed in the folding groove 20 by the contact between the roller 25 and the crossbar 21, and the elevating frame 38 is pulled. It is not in contact with the plate 32.

本発明装置が作動する時、まず収納箱10を握り、握りリング18を回転させ、それによりネジ軸40が回転し、ネジ軸40のねじ山による連結により活動ヒンジ連結盤44が上昇し、フック46を隠し溝11から押し出し、それにより引っ掛けることと取ることが便利になり、活動ヒンジ連結盤44の上への移動によりヒンジ連結フレーム42の水平方向の距離が減少され、復帰バネ14の弾性の復帰を通して押出ロッド13を連動させて向かい合ってスライドさせ、足踏み式ポンプ50との当接を放し、この時、遮蔽蓋26はリミットボール17がスライドフレーム30と当接するまで降り、横木21が回転して外へ広がり、且つ抑制ブロック28により当接して引っかかリ、その間の夾角は鈍角であり、それにより正常に服を掛けて乾かす機能を果たせる。 When the device of the present invention is activated, the storage box 10 is first gripped and the grip ring 18 is rotated, whereby the screw shaft 40 is rotated, and the active hinge connecting plate 44 is raised by the screw thread connection of the screw shaft 40, and the hook is hooked. The 46 is pushed out of the hidden groove 11 so that it is convenient to hook and take, and the movement of the active hinge connecting plate 44 onto the hinge connecting frame 42 reduces the horizontal distance of the hinge connecting frame 42 and makes the return spring 14 elastic. Through the return, the extrusion rods 13 are interlocked and slid facing each other to release the contact with the foot-operated pump 50. At this time, the shielding lid 26 descends until the limit ball 17 comes into contact with the slide frame 30, and the crossbar 21 rotates. It spreads out and is scratched by the restraining block 28, and the hinge angle between them is blunt, so that it can normally hang clothes and dry.

首回りが小さくて掛けにくい服を乾かす時、折畳箱19を握り、握りリング18を回転させ、それによりネジ軸40が回転し、ネジ軸40がねじ山による連結により平滑ロッド39を引き板32と当接するまで下へ移動させ、引き板32が向かい合って回転し、且つ止めバネ33を圧縮し、プッシュロッド29により抑制ブロック28を引き動かして向かい合って移動させ、それにより横木21の回転する角度がより大きくなり、その間の夾角を鋭角にし、服を掛け又は取ることに便利を与え、服を掛け又は取った後に握りリング18を放せばよく、引っ張りバネ41の弾性が復帰することで上記の作動過程を逆方向に作動させ、これにより横木21が再び伸び広がる。 When drying clothes that are difficult to hang due to the small neck circumference, grip the folding box 19 and rotate the grip ring 18, thereby rotating the screw shaft 40, and the screw shaft 40 pulls the smooth rod 39 by connecting with threads. Move down until it comes into contact with 32, the pull plate 32 rotates facing each other, and the stop spring 33 is compressed, and the restraining block 28 is pulled by the push rod 29 to move facing each other, whereby the crossbar 21 rotates. The angle becomes larger, the angle between them becomes acute, it is convenient to hang or take clothes, and after hanging or taking clothes, the grip ring 18 may be released, and the elasticity of the tension spring 41 is restored, so that the above The operation process of is operated in the opposite direction, whereby the crossbar 21 stretches and spreads again.
